I guess that's enough to consider re-adding this package > > > to the tree, but I won't take that decision alone. :) > > > > I added the licence (thank to Matthew for doing my homework :-) and > > apply the Path and Compiler nitpick from jca. > > > > I hope, that this revision of this port is right and OK for everybody. > > > > Thanks for you help, > > Jan > > comments inline > > | # $OpenBSD$ > | > | COMMENT= tools for building tcp socket client/servers > | > | DISTNAME= ucspi-tcp-0.88 > | REVISION= 0 > > (to confirm for anyone questioning this line, it *is* correct > as we previously had ucspi-tcp-0.88). > > | CATEGORIES= net > > please fix <space><tab> > > | > | HOMEPAGE= http://cr.yp.to/ucspi-tcp.html > | MAINTAINER= Jan Klemkow <[email protected]> > | > | PERMIT_PACKAGE_CDROM= Yes > | WANTLIB= c > > prefer a blank line before WANTLIB as done in Makefile.template and > most other ports. > > | # Public domain > > since it's not in the tarball, please add the URL to djb's announcement > about this. > > | MASTER_SITES= http://cr.yp.to/ucspi-tcp/ > | MASTER_SITES+= http://www.fefe.de/ucspi/ > | PATCHFILES= ucspi-tcp-0.88-ipv6.diff19.bz2 > > don't try and fetch the patch file from cr.yp.to; instead use > MASTER_SITES0 and add :0 to PATCHFILES. see mutt for an example. > > | PATCH_DIST_STRIP= > | ALL_TARGET= > | > | NO_TEST= Yes > | > | DOCFILES= TODO README > | BINFILES= tcpserver tcpclient tcprules tcprulescheck > | MANFILES= tcpserver.1 tcpclient.1 tcprules.1 tcprulescheck.1 > | > | do-configure: > | echo "${CC} ${CFLAGS}" > ${WRKSRC}/conf-cc > | echo "${CC} ${LDFLAGS}" > ${WRKSRC}/conf-ld > | echo "${TRUEPREFIX}" > ${WRKSRC}/conf-home > | > | do-install: > | ${INSTALL_DATA_DIR} ${PREFIX}/share/doc/ucspi-tcp > | .for f in ${BINFILES} > | ${INSTALL_PROGRAM} ${WRKSRC}/${f} ${PREFIX}/bin > | .endfor > | .for f in ${MANFILES} > | ${INSTALL_MAN} ${WRKSRC}/${f} ${PREFIX}/man/man1 > | .endfor > | .for f in ${DOCFILES} > | ${INSTALL_DATA} ${WRKSRC}/${f} ${PREFIX}/share/doc/ucspi-tcp > | .endfor > > the old port used upstream's install target, with this: > > pre-install: > @echo ${PREFIX} > ${WRKSRC}/conf-home > > seems much neater than all the DOCFILES=blah BINFILES=bla MANFILES=... > and multiple lines in do-install. > > the old port also had this...is this or something like it still needed? > > # datasize limit in 'run' files is too low for ld.so > # to be able to pull in libc > LDFLAGS+= -static > > | .include <bsd.port.mk> >
